Short track is in a hockey rink, and consists of a 111m oval. Long track you have to have a specially made 400m track, usually outdoors.

AnswerThere are two basic types of speed skates: Short Track and Long Track. Long track boots are lower cut than short track boots, and the blade is also somewhat flatter than a short track blade.Refer to the link for photos and further information.
